What is the role of AI agents in translating Level 10 Meeting actions into actionable website improvements for AI Website Creation?
AI agents play a transformative role in bridging the gap between strategic discussions in Level 10 Meetings and concrete website improvements within an AI Website Creation and Vibe Coding framework. Traditionally, action items ('To-Dos') from these meetings require manual interpretation, planning, and execution by marketing or development teams. With AI agents, this process becomes significantly streamlined and automated.
First, AI agents can be integrated to ingest the outcomes of Level 10 Meetings. This might involve processing meeting notes, transcribed audio, or structured data inputs outlining specific To-Dos related to the company's digital presence. For example, if a meeting concludes with a To-Do to 'improve conversion rate on the product page by highlighting customer testimonials,' the AI agent interprets this directive.
Leveraging its understanding of Vibe Coding, user experience patterns, and the brand's established digital identity, the AI agent then translates this qualitative goal into quantifiable, actionable website changes. It might suggest specific testimonial layouts, analyze existing testimonials for optimal impact, or even generate new content variations aligned with the desired emotional response. The agent can then either directly implement these changes within the AI website creation platform (if configured for autonomous action) or propose them for human review and approval.
This process aligns with the principles of 'Building effective agents' by Anthropic, where agents are designed to dynamically direct their own processes and tool usage. Here, the 'tool use' involves interacting with the website's content management system, Vibe Coding parameters, and analytical tools. This leads to rapid iteration cycles, ensuring that crucial strategic decisions from Level 10 Meetings are reflected on the website quickly and effectively, maintaining momentum and responsiveness to business needs.
